@media(max-width: 1400px) and (min-width:768px){
	.header .top .wel{
		width: 40%;
		-webkit-line-clamp: 1;
		display: -webkit-box;
		-webkit-box-orient: vertical;
		overflow: hidden;
	}
	.banner{
		height: 36rem;
	}
	
	.inNews,.ab_f,.in_appli,.process{
		width:94%;
		margin:auto;
	}
	.ab_f.process ul li .text p{
		-webkit-line-clamp: 3;
		display: -webkit-box;
		-webkit-box-orient: vertical;
		overflow: hidden;
	}
	.in_appli ul li{
		width: calc(33.33% - 0.6rem);
	}
	.in_appli ul li:nth-child(3n){
		margin-right:0;
	}
	.in_appli ul li:nth-child(4n){
		margin-right:0.8rem;
	}
	.in_appli ul li .gli{
		top: 0;
		height: auto;
	}
	.in_appli ul li .text{
		top: 0;
		position: absolute;
		z-index: 3;
		overflow: hidden;
		background: #055eb28c;
	}
	.in_appli ul li .imag p{
		display:none;
	}
	.ab_f .ab_fl{
		width: 50%;
	}
	.ab_f .index_ab h4 a{
		width: 25%;
	}
	.ab_f .index_ab h4 p{
		width: 40%;
	}
	.ab_f .ab_fr{
		margin-top: 13rem;
	}
	.ab_f .ab_fr:after{
		width: 170px;
		left: 158px;
		top: -121px;
	}
	.footer .center{
		width:94%;
		margin:auto;
	}
	.footer .f_left{
		display: none;
	}
	.footer .f_cont{
		width: 72%;
	}
	.aCont,.a-profile,.a-btn{
		width:94%;
		margin:auto;
	}
	.a-btn ul a{
		display: block;
		width: 33.33%;
		float: left;
		text-align: left;
		padding: 1rem 0;
	}
	.a-profile .text p:nth-child(2){
		-webkit-line-clamp: 1;
		display: -webkit-box;
		-webkit-box-orient: vertical;
		overflow: hidden;
	}
	.a-material .text ul li{
		margin-bottom: 2rem;
	}
	.process ul li .text p{
		-webkit-line-clamp: 5;
		display: -webkit-box;
		-webkit-box-orient: vertical;
		overflow: hidden;
	}
	.a-mission ul li{
		width: 100%;
	}
	.a-mission ul li p{
		width: 90%;
	}
	.header .column ul li ul.sub-menu li ul li a{
		-webkit-line-clamp: 1;
		display: -webkit-box;
		-webkit-box-orient: vertical;
		overflow: hidden;
	}
	.pro_lists .pro_lists_right li p{
		font-size: 1.4rem;
	}
	.conews .content,.s_material{
		width:94%;
		margin:auto;
	}
	.header .column ul li ul.sub-menu{
		height:auto;
	}
	.pro_lists .pro_lists_a ul li h3{
		font-size: 1.6rem;
		-webkit-line-clamp: 1;
		display: -webkit-box;
		-webkit-box-orient: vertical;
		overflow: hidden;
	}
	.listb{
		height: 30rem;
	}
	.contus{
		width:94%;
	}
	.contimg{
		display:none;
	}
	.head_search{
		margin-right: 1%;
	}
	.header .content .logo{
		width: 23%;
	}
	.header .content .logo img{
		width: 86%;
		margin: 2rem 7%;
	}
    .header .column ul li{
		width: 14rem;
	}
	.totop{
		right:5%;
	}
}
